Acquia Drupal-Site-Builder Exam Syllabus Topics:
| Section | Weight | Objectives |
|---|---|---|
| Site Configuration | 15% | - User Role and Permission Management - Search Configuration - Module Configuration - Configuration Management |
| Site Building Fundamentals | 20% | - Taxonomy Architecture - Content Workflow and States - Content Types and Fields - Entity Reference Relationships |
| Multilingual and Internationalization | 10% | - Interface Translation - Content Translation - Configuration Translation - Language Configuration |
| Site Display and Presentation | 20% | - Views Displays and Filters - Webform Integration - Media Management - Views Module Fundamentals |
| Drupal 10/11 Specific Features | 15% | - Olivero and Claro Themes - Modern Module Usage - CKEditor 5 Configuration - JSON:API and REST Configuration |
| Layout and User Interface | 20% | - View Modes and Display Settings - Block System and Placement - Layout Builder - Theme Configuration |
Acquia Certified Drupal Site Builder Exam for Drupal 10, 11 Sample Questions:
Question 1
You have installed a contributed module called "Sample Module" that looks like it will be a great fit for the business case you are trying to solve. However, upon closer examination, it looks like the module only supplies a drush command; it does not have an admin interface.
As a site builder with no command-line experience, this will not work for you! You need a web user interface to use this module.
How should you request a web UI in the module's issue queue?
A. Create a "Plan" issue for the module with the subject line, "Create web UI for Sample Module."
B. Create a "Feature Request" issue for the module with the subject line, "Create web UI for Sample Module."
C. Create a "Bug Report" issue for the module with the subject line, "Create web UI for Sample Module."
D. Create a "Feature Request" issue for the module with the subject line, "URGENT: Module Broken!!!Needs UI."
Question 2
Your site has three Content types with a Media reference field. The field is configured to Media type as Image. You noticed that some users are adding animated GIF files while adding the content, which are very distracting.
How can you disallow adding files with .gif extension on all the Content types which use the Media reference field?
A. Edit the Media type Image and remove gif from "image" field settings in the Manage fields tab.
B. Edit the Content types and update Media field settings in Manage form display tab.
C. Edit the Content types and disallow .gif extension in the Media reference field settings.
D. Edit the Media type Image and update media type settings to disallow .gif files.
Question 3
Your Main navigation menu has two levels of menu items like sections, and child pages within each section.
Your UX team wants to make it easier for a site visitor viewing a child page to see what other pages are in that section. They have asked you to add a submenu to the Sidebar region on child pages.
How can you add a submenu to the child pages that shows all child pages in the section?
A. Add the Main navigation menu to the Sidebar region, and use CSS to hide the top level menu items.
B. In Block layout, place the Main navigation block in the Sidebar region. Set the initial visibility level to
2.
C. Create a new menu for each main section containing links for each child page, and add each menu's block to the Sidebar region.
D. In Block layout, place the Main navigation block in the Sidebar region. Set the initial visibility level to
1.
Question 4
You have created a custom block "Festival Offer" and placed this block in the header section of your site.
Your site has a "Premium customer" user role. You need to show this block only on the front page and only to users who have a "Premium customer" user role.
Which two visibility settings you need to make to the "Festival Offer" block to achieve these requirements?
A. Select the user role "Premium customer" from the Roles tab.
B. Add < front > path in the Pages tab and select "Show for the listed pages".
C. Remove < front > path in the Pages tab & select "Hide for the listed pages".
D. Select the user role "Authenticated user" from the Roles tab.
Question 5
Your website has a content type named Hotel with a Taxonomy reference field for Landmarks vocabulary.
You want to create a view to list all the hotels filtered by landmarks as a contextual filter.
How will you pass the term name in the URL for the contextual filter?
A. Add Landmarks vocabulary as a contextual filter and pass term name as a contextual filter.
B. Add Landmarks vocabulary as a relationship and then add Landmarks vocabulary as a contextual filter.
C. Add Landmarks vocabulary as an exposed filter pass term name as the filter value.
D. Add Landmarks vocabulary both as an exposed filter and contextual filter.
Solutions:
| Question 1 Answer: B | Question 2 Answer: A | Question 3 Answer: B | Question 4 Answer: A,B | Question 5 Answer: A |
